Farm fence repair services involve restoring or replacing fencing structures on agricultural properties to ensure they function effectively. These services typically include fixing broken or damaged fence panels, posts, and wires, as well as reinforcing or replacing entire sections of fencing. Skilled contractors assess the condition of existing fences, identify weak points or areas prone to failure, and perform necessary repairs to extend the fence’s lifespan and maintain its integrity. Proper repair work helps prevent issues related to livestock escape, unauthorized access, and property boundary disputes.

The primary problems addressed by farm fence repair services include damage caused by weather, animals, or general wear and tear. Over time, fences can become loose, sagging, or broken due to strong winds, heavy snowfall, or animal activity. Additionally, fencing may deteriorate from rot, rust, or corrosion, especially in humid or coastal regions. Repairing these issues helps property owners avoid livestock escaping, protect crops, and maintain clear property boundaries, ultimately reducing potential losses and security concerns.

Farm fence repair services are commonly used on a variety of property types, including large agricultural farms, ranches, and smaller homesteads. These properties often require sturdy fencing to contain livestock such as cattle, horses, or sheep, and to delineate property lines. Commercial farms with extensive landholdings may need regular fence maintenance to ensure operational efficiency, while smaller rural properties also benefit from timely repairs to prevent animals from wandering off or intruders from entering.

Professional fence repair contractors typically work with different fencing materials suited to rural and agricultural settings. Common options include wire fences, wooden fences, and electric fencing, each requiring specific repair techniques. Whether addressing rusted wire mesh, broken wooden posts, or malfunctioning electric lines, local service providers offer tailored solutions to restore fence functionality. Material Costs - The cost of fencing materials can vary widely, typically ranging from $2 to $10 per linear foot depending on the type of fence, such as wood, wire, or vinyl. For a standard farm fence, material expenses may be around $300 to $1,500 for a 150-foot section.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for fence repair services generally fall between $50 and $100 per hour. The total labor fee depends on the extent of damage and the size of the area needing repair, often totaling $200 to $1,200.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ses might include posts, gates, or hardware, which can add $50 to $300 to the overall project. Unexpected issues, such as buried debris or damaged posts, may also increase costs.

Project Pricing - Overall project costs for farm fence repairs typically range from $500 to $3,000, depending on the scope, materials, and local service provider rates. Contact local pros to get tailored estimates for specific repair need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
